Frequently Asked Questions about Pet Friendly La Mirada Landmark Apartments

What is the Cheapest Pet Friendly apartment in La Mirada Landmark?

Currently the most affordable Pet Friendly Apartment in La Mirada Landmark is at Fullerton Court Apartments listed at $1,550.

How much is the average rent for a Pet Friendly La Mirada Landmark Apartment?

The average rent for a Pet Friendly Apartment in La Mirada Landmark is $2,409.

What is the largest Pet Friendly La Mirada Landmark Apartment for rent?

Today's Pet Friendly apartment with the most square footage in La Mirada Landmark is a 1,116 square feet unit starting from $2,095 at Rosebeach.
